Creatine Stimulates Protein SynthesisIt has been demonstrated that creatine may also promote muscle growth by stimulating protein synthesis in two ways. Firstly, from the increased work you are able to do as a result of its energy replenishing actions. Secondly is that the more creatine phosphate (CP) that is stored in muscle, the more water is drawn into muscle making it fuller and stronger. With more CP and water in muscle, the volume increases, and the muscle cell is volumized or 'super-hydrated'. A volumized muscle helps to trigger protein synthesis, minimize protein breakdown and increase glycogen synthesis (Haussinger 1996; 1996). If a muscle is then trained properly, this could lead to enhanced muscle growth. The muscle 'pump' experienced when using creatine is reported to be much more intense, and this is as a result of the cell volumizing effect. How does creatine work?Studies show that when athletes supplement with creatine while weight training, they can quickly gain lean body mass and strength - sometimes within a week. A study conducted by the University of Memphis divided 63 athletes into three groups. The groups were given either a protein and carbohydrate supplement with creatine monohydrate, a protein and carbohydrate supplement without creatine monohydrate, or a carbohydrate placebo. In one month, the athletes taking creatine monohydrate gained 5-7 pounds of lean mass which far exceeded the two groups not taking creatine. Muscle cells generate mechanical work from an energy liberating chemical reaction -- ATP is split into ADP and P (phosphate). ATP can be used by muscle cells very quickly, but there is only an extremely limited supply -- usually only enough for a few seconds of high intensity work. When the ATP is gone, work stops. Fortunately, the body has several ways to convert ADP back to ATP. The fastest method is to move the phosphate group off of phosphocreatine and onto ADP. This yields ATP -- which is immediately available for muscular work -- and creatine. There is enough phosphocreatine to keep ATP levels up for several more seconds. So at this point we've moved from 2 - 3 seconds of all-out work (ATP) to almost 10 seconds (ATP + creatine). The body can recharge creatine back to phosphocreatine, but this takes time (approximately 30-60 seconds). This ATP + creatine system makes up the fastest component of the anaerobic system, and is most used by power athletes.
